Rosa Littleton I’m no expert, but I googled it & first you need a male and a female tree which you can only tell on a mature, flowering tree, secondly it’s an inferior plant to the parent, and thirdly, it can take 5+ years or even much longer to bear fruit. If you want a specific date you need an offshoot of that tree, not a seed. Seedlings can grow into a variety of palms and typically don't have good fruit.
